Documentation for the template: Miscellaneous Publication Content (transcluded from Template:Miscellaneous Publication Content/Doc).
Purpose
This template is to be placed on the image description page for a Miscellaneous Publication Content image used to document a portion of a publication under fair use. Please note that specific fair use templates are available to document a publication's cover or any illustrations, logos, and signatures that may be found in a publication. This template would be used with other material that does not fall into those categories.
Usage
Call this template as:
{{Miscellaneous Publication Content
|Pub=<TAG>
}}
or as:
{{Miscellaneous Publication Content|<TAG>}}
or as:
{{Miscellaneous Publication Content|<TAG>|<publication title>}}
or as:
{{Miscellaneous Publication Content
|Pub=<TAG>
|Title=<publication title>
}}
Note: In all the above examples, when a parameter is shown in angle brackets, like:
<Parameter>
then the parameter, and the angle brackets, should be replaced by the value of the parameter. For example: Title=<TITLE>
should become Title=The Name of the Book
(or whatever the name might be).
Parameters
- Pub must specify a publication record tag or record number, an acceptable argument to Template:P (which see). If the "Pub=" parameter is not present, the first unnamed parameter is used. One or the other must be present and valid for the template to work correctly
- Title is used to specify the title of the publication, for display. If an unnamed parameter is used for Pub, a 2nd unnamed parameter may be used for title.
